    Please help!
    I am supporting a user with an 8830 who is having browser issues. He is unable to connect to any web pages.
    We have closed the browser from the menu and re-opened it. We have re-registered the HRT. We have deleted the service books relating to browser(Browser Config for 5 Click and Blackberry Internet Browsing Service) and resent the service books. We have pulled the battery out and restarted the device. All options are checked in the Browser Configuration page.
    Style sheets media type: Handheld
    Show images: on WML & HTML Pages
    Emulation Mode: BlackBerry
    Content Mode:WML & HTML


    Any advice? Should I get the user to wipe the device and start over? Any help would be greatly appreciated!

    So anyway, an update: The battery pull was done first before the hrt was re-registered and the service books were deleted and resent. I was thinking about my steps when I thought that maybe a battery pull AFTER the service books were restored might help. BINGO! Browser loads fine now.

    Glad you got it working, but another thing to add to your list of knowledge. If this was by chance a new phone, sometimes the provisioning for DATA doesn't take on the actual phone. Sometimes because it's not properly provisioned by the personelle at the store. A *228 provision dial will usually solve this. Just FYI.
